Transaction 7583694f7259a4451e08ce1cbfdd044345e7182f4ec47e0d2d57bf06476ee7b9

1 Input
2 Outputs
  • 7583694f7259a4451e08ce1cbfdd044345e7182f4ec47e0d2d57bf06476ee7b9:0
  • value  24725274
    address  3GEJPbt2KAudNCkq621es3BNeYdMcQPdDX
  • 7583694f7259a4451e08ce1cbfdd044345e7182f4ec47e0d2d57bf06476ee7b9:1
  • value  80203247
    address  37ZbsbVh4asFYhBFP8qnUXYLcrnTf44gFd